POSITIVE ELECTRODE FOR LITHIUM ION BATTERY AND LITHIUM ION BATTERY

Last updated:

Abstract:

Provided is a positive electrode for a lithium ion battery that realizes an increase in energy density and is capable of improving durability. A positive electrode for a lithium ion battery (21) has a positive electrode current collector (21A) and a positive electrode mixture layer (21B) formed on the positive electrode current collector (21A). The positive electrode mixture layer (21B) contains a lithium nickel composite oxide and a metallic phosphate that coats the lithium nickel composite oxide. The lithium nickel composite oxide is represented by a chemical formula LiNi.sub.xCo.sub.yM.sub.zO.sub.2 (in the formula, M is one or more elements selected from the group consisting of Mn, Al, Mg and W, x+y+z=1 and 0.6.ltoreq.x<1.0). The metallic phosphate is one or more materials selected from the group consisting of VPO.sub.4, VP.sub.2O.sub.7 and VPO.sub.4F. The mass ratio of the metallic phosphate to the lithium nickel composite oxide is 0.01 mass % or more and 20 mass % or less.
